    I don't understand the question really... But here's a go..

    You are only allowed two waitlists. I believe a waitlist is a day or consecutive span of days at a particular resort.

    If you waitlist, if something comes available, then you will be notified and can opt in or out of that.

    You are welcome to call each and every day to ask if there is availability at some place that you want to stay. This does involve more work on your part, but you can do that and this is NOT considered a waitlist.

    Many folks have been on a waitlist, but not yet notified of availabilty and asked for a room and gotten it. This to me kindof defeats the purpose of the waitlist, but the waitlist does save 15-20 minutes a day on the phone with member services.

    If you ABSOLUTELY need to get a room at a particular resort though, it does pay to call often.

    Just FYI, when they changed the waitlist rules to limit you to two waitlists, they also now automatically rebook your reservation if the waitlist comes through--they no longer notify you to ask if you still want it.
